Transaction 523277d2993246a79cd5b62c5232a188021fcc8aa4fc911b77de3ae7aaa5002c

2 Input
1 Outputs
  • 523277d2993246a79cd5b62c5232a188021fcc8aa4fc911b77de3ae7aaa5002c:0
  • value  570890
    address  3LYXNT3s3EciYv9KkAynf6RByS2D6j2nfy